Asbestos Inspections and Surveys

For building owners who desire a determination of the location, quantity and condition of their asbestos-containing materials (ACM), EMG can perform a comprehensive asbestos survey. EMG provides:

  • On-site, certified asbestos survey technician
  • Stringent sampling strategy and protocols
  • Representative bulk sample collection of the suspect ACM
  • Individually sealed, uncompromised samples for in-house or outsourced lab analysis
  • Choice of polarized light microscopy analysis (PLM), phase contract microscopy (PCM), or transmission electron microscopy (TEM) analysis
  • American Industrial Hygiene Association (AIHA) and National Voluntary Laboratory Accreditation Program (NVLAP) Laboratory Results
  • Documentation of asbestos-containing materials’ location, quantity, appearance, and condition.
  • Comprehensive report of data collected and recommended scope of work for remediation.

Asbestos Materials Testing

When suspect asbestos-containing materials are encountered, we can provide sampling and polarized light microscopy analysis of the suspect material in an accredited laboratory. EMG is capable of a wide range of analytical services for each of its projects and provides timely analytical services. Microscopic laboratory analysis options of air samples include phase contract microscopy (PCM) in accordance with NIOSH Method 7400, and transmission electron microscopy (TEM) analysis of air samples for a more definitive quantification of the airborne asbestos concentration.
